Local Coffee Club is an online subscription service that offers freshly roasted coffee beans from independent roasters located in your area or elsewhere in the UK. The service includes a bag that fits in a letterbox and a recyclable box. You can select between cafetiere, filter and espresso ground beans. You can sign up for the service weekly, monthly, or fortnightly. Each bag is equipped with a QR code which links to a comprehensive brewing guide as well as tasting notes and origin details.

Alpaca Coffee, a sustainable specialty brand, sources its beans ethically. They also contribute 1percent of their profits to environmental causes and make use of packaging that is non-plastic. They believe that the current commercial coffee industry doesn't work for the planet or its people and they're determined change it.

Their products are roasted in Rookley on the Isle of Wight. They've even teamed up with Community Arts Projects which employs prisoners from the local prison to produce artwork for their bags. Victoria, the founder of the company, is a passionate advocate for sustainability. She wants her products and brand to reflect what she wants to see change in the world.

This coffee is sourced from the Pereira region of Risaralda located in Colombia. It is a full-flavored medium-bodied coffee with notes that include orange and chocolate. It is decaffeinated through the natural method. This is done by using sugarcane fermentation as a byproduct to remove caffeine from beans 1kg without damaging them.

Coffee grounds are a great addition to garden soil. They can be a great source for nutrients and improve the texture. They can also help prevent weed growth and increase moisture levels in the soil. It's important to understand how much to add. Too much will impede root development and cause the plant to be less healthy.

Another benefit of organic coffee beans 1kg grounds is that they can be utilized as a natural fertilizer. They contain nitrogen, phosphorous, and potassium (NPK), which are all vital nutrients needed for the growth of plants. These nutrients are often missing in the soil of backyard gardens, and adding them can improve the health of plants and increase their vigor. NPK is an effective and safe substitute for chemical fertilizers.
